News and Narrative: Exploring the Overlap of Story and Article
In today's media landscape, the lines between news reporting and narrative storytelling are becoming increasingly fragile. Journalists are utilizing narrative techniques to resonate audiences, transforming dry factual reports into compelling stories. This shift reflects a growing appreciation that people connect with information presented in a narrative format.
The use of narrative in news offers several perks. It allows journalists to personalize complex issues, making them more relatable to readers. By weaving in personal testimonies, stories can evoke emotions and create a deeper understanding. Moreover, narrative structures can provide context and insight that traditional news formats may lack.
This evolving landscape raises important questions about the role of truth in storytelling and the potential for bias. While narrative can be a powerful tool for engagement, it's essential to maintain objectivity. Journalists must strive to integrate compelling narratives with factual reporting, ensuring that stories remain grounded in reality while effectively sharing information.
